I started laser hair removal a couple months ago and just recently I started taking Zoloft 50mg. Are there any side effects? Should I not do it if I'm taking this medicine?

Answer: Taking Zoloft during laser hair removal It's fine to take Zoloft during laser hair removal. While some medications can make the skin more sensitive to heat and light, Zoloft is not one of them. Please be sure to let your provider know of any changes to your health or medications.
